About The Position

In this role, you will work closely with the Director, Global Risk and Insurance to support West commercial insurance strategies worldwide. Role requires active participation in all phases of property/casualty insurance placements, including identifying potential loss exposures and analyzing appropriate risk finance techniques for management response. Responsibilities will involve marketing and placement of designated insurance policies, as well as providing ongoing oversight and support for financial and claims administration duties as may be required.

Responsibilities

  • Understand and promote Corporate objectives and functional insurance/risk management requirements.
  • Maintain strong working relationships with internal (Finance, Law, Procurement, Engineering, Operations and Quality representatives on the Corporate and local levels) and external (insurance brokers, underwriters, consultants, customers, vendors, and suppliers) clients. Maintain working knowledge of the global property/casualty insurance marketplace.
  • Support property/casualty insurance negotiations from compiling exposure data and preparing submissions through final placement; requirements include support document verification and ongoing maintenance support.
  • Coordinate internal engineering recommendations and construction updates through WPS’ commercial property program; support internal workflow review protocols for carrier response.
  • Monitor compliance with carrier underwriting requirements; coordinate resources and preliminary responses for approval.
  • Assist with claims management and reporting.
  • Review loss runs; identify costs/benefits of insurable v. retained risks, participate in claim reviews and strategy sessions with senior management. Prepare monthly/quarterly loss reports for Corporate review as requested.
  • Process internal invoice requisitions and billing documents for supervisory approval. Review invoice statements for accuracy and address billing issues to final resolution.
